Book description
Written as a business leadership fable, The Transparent Leader is the story of a smart emerging leader, Stephanie Marcus, as she navigates the challenging world of business. Fortunately, Steph meets Lou Donaldson, a public relations CEO near the end of his career, at a local gym where she works out daily. Lou acts as a friend, informal coach, and mentor as he guides Steph through the complicated business ecosystem in which she finds herself. Throughout the story, Steph learns about clear leadership communication as she also adapts and changes and becomes a more transparent—clear and open—leader. At the same time, she learns Lou's personal story, which helps her fully appreciate his wisdom.
